Medley: When Irish Eyes Are Smiling / Black Velvet Band / The Boys from County Armagh / When Irish Eyes Are Smiling (Reprise)

๐ Lyrics
When Irish eyes are smiling
Sure it's like a morn in spring
In the lilt of Irish laughter
You can hear the angels sing
When Irish hearts are happy
All the world seems bright and gay
And when Irish eyes are smiling
Sure they steal your heart away
As I was walking down Broadway
Not intending to stay very long
When who should I meet but this pretty fair maid
As she came tripping along
A watch she pulled out of her pocket
And slipped it right into my hand
On the very first day that I met her
Bad luck to her black velvet band
Her eyes the shone like diamonds
You would think she was queen of the land
And her hair it hung over her shoulders
Tied up with a black velvet band
There's one fair county in Ireland
With memories so glorious and grand
Where nature has lavished its bounty
It's the orchard of Eireann's green land
I love its cathedrals and city
Once founded by Patrick, so true
And it bears in the heart of its bosom
The ashes of Brian Boru
It's my own Irish home
Far across the fold
Although I've often left it
In foreign lands to roam
No matter where I wander
Through cities near or far
My heart's at home in old Ireland
In the County of Armagh
When Irish eyes are smiling
Sure it's like a morn in spring
In the lilt of Irish laughter
You can hear the angels sing
When Irish hearts are happy
All the world seems bright and gay
And when Irish eyes are smiling
Sure they steal your heart away
And when Irish eyes are smiling
Sure they steal your heart away
